GitHub: revertir el compromiso intermedio

Tenemos algo de compromiso en git que se agregó erróneamente. Hemos hecho más compromisos también por encima de ese compromiso incorrecto. Ahora quiero eliminar esa confirmación sin afectar otras confirmaciones.

¿Hay alguna forma de eliminarlo?

Por favor guía

eliminar esa confirmación sin afectar a otras confirmaciones

Use git revert : eso creará una nueva confirmación que cancelará las que no desea ver. Podrás impulsar ese nuevo compromiso.
Puede revertir un range de commits .

Pero eso significa que los datos de esos "comimts incorrectos" permanecen en la historia.

Puede revertir cualquier confirmación, independientemente de dónde se encuentre en su historial. Simplemente escriba git revert <sha> .

Es posible que tenga que resolver un conflicto si hay conflictos.